Sheet of Ice Damages Car Windshield

On Saturday around 10:50 a.m., police in Hudson, New Hampshire, responded to the incident on Route 111 near the Windham town line.

Police say a large sheet of ice caused serious damage when it came off of one vehicle and struck another.

The car that was struck was able to pull over, despite heavy damage to the windshield. The motorist, 35-year-old Lisa Beauchemin, and her two young daughters were not injured.

According to police, the driver of the van that the ice came from did not stop at the scene. They say that motorist is responsible for the damage caused to Beauchemin's vehicle.
